What companies run services between Thamrin City, Indonesia and Bandung, Indonesia?

Jackal Holidays operates a bus from Jackal Holidays Blora to Pasteur hourly. Tickets cost Rp 160,000–180,000 and the journey takes 1h 57m.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Thamrin City to Bandung via Karet, Manggarai, Bekasi, and Cikampek in around 5h 23m.
